[0015] The specific operation includes the following steps:
[0016] 1. Cultivation of moon jellyfish under normal salinity. The moon jellyfish grows to about 3 cm at a normal breeding salinity of 30. It has relatively strong vitality and no individual damage. At this time, most of the moon jellyfish are thick round cakes, and there is no big difference in size.
[0017] 2. Change the salinity of seawater in groups, thereby changing the shape of the moon jellyfish. It is mainly divided into two groups, one with increasing salinity and one with decreased salinity. When the salinity changes, it should be done slowly, and the salinity should be increased or decreased by 1-2 per day. The lower the salinity, the smaller the thickness of the umbrella body of the moon jellyfish, and the higher the salinity, the greater the thickness of the umbrella body of the moon jellyfish.
